Grasping Banner Dimensions


Regarding picking the suitable banner dimension, comprehending the different dimensions available is crucial. Banners can fulfill multiple purposes, ranging from outdoor advertising to online advertisements, and each context generally needs a distinct size to guarantee highest visibility and success. The measurements of a banner can impact not only its aesthetic appeal but also how well it conveys its content.


One of the most common sizes for banners, notably for events or trade shows, is the regular 24 by 72 inch portrait banner. This size is perfect for creating an striking display that can be readily seen by attendees. On the other hand, landscape banners such as the 36 by 72 inch layout can be better suited for larger spaces or storefronts, offering sufficient room for graphics and text while maintaining readability from a distance.


Moreover, digital banners come with a selection of size options customized for multiple online platforms. Common web banner sizes include 728 by 90 pixels for leaderboard ads and 300 by 250 pixels for medium rectangles. Common Banner Dimensions


As you selecting ads for your occasion or promotional campaign, knowing typical banner dimensions is important. The most frequently used size for digital advertising is 728 by 90 pixels, known as a leaderboard. This dimension works well at the top of websites and is readily viewable on both desktop and desktop and mobile screens, which makes it a preferred choice for site designers.


A different popular size is 300 by 250 pixels, known to as a standard rectangle. This dimension is flexible and can be placed inside content or on the periphery of webpages. Its small nature enables it to attract attention without overwhelming visitors, resulting in interaction that’s advantageous for your promotional goals.


For larger ads, the 970 by 250 pixel dimension, commonly called a large banner banner, is an excellent choice. This size provides sufficient space for artistic graphics and messages, which can attract the audience’s focus. Billboards work well on busy websites or during events where exposure is crucial for enhancing effectiveness.


Selecting the Best Size for Your Requirements


As selecting banner sizes, it’s essential to take into account the principal objective of your poster. When you’re trying to grab focus in a cluttered space, more sizable sizes such as billboards or event banners might be ideal. On the other hand, if you require something more discreet, smaller sizes such as pop-up banners or social media graphics might be more appropriate. Evaluate the setting where the banner will be shown to make sure it fits with your goals.


Think about the people you are speaking to and their distance from the sign. For instance, a sign intended for a nearby view should have a distinct size versus one intended for a street display seen from far away. Grasping the situation in which your audience will see the poster will help you towards the best size that ensures highest visibility and impression.


Lastly, take into account the design elements you wish to include. Bigger banners permit richer illustrations and text, while smaller sizes may necessitate less complex designs to express your content successfully. It is vital to align size with content to maintain clearness and appeal.
